Got an N95 last week, and allthough its an amazing phone, there are just a couple of things bugging me.

Firstly, you cannot have a full screen wallpaper (I assume its possible, by creating your own theme on a PC but its a bit long winded)

No countdown timer (I used to use it a lot for cooking on my old phone)

No video screensavers (My mums old 6280 used to be able to do this, but a later model cannot??) And also no video ringtones.

And finally, the orange light stays on when you are filming video which is annoying if you are filming close up or at night.

The rest of the problems I encountered im sure can be fixed by upgrading the firmware (GPS is crap/keep getting Memory Full error/battery life poor)

Other than that, its a great phone, but ive had SE handsets for the past 2 years so I guess its gonna take some getting used to.

You have to remember this is a smartphone, its completely customisable. All the things you want (and more) are provided by third party software. You can change the menus, have it read text messages to you etc etc And the best thing is some of this is free. Nokia have a beta lab, where you can test new software, like the new conversation software (select someone in your phonebook and see the texts from them and your reply as a converstion). Or Nokia Widsets which is free, or Yahoo Go! Which is free.

As I said there are programs to do everything you say. There is a memory program built-in, there is also a very comprehensive free program called PhoneNetinfo which will tell you everything you will ever need to know about the phone, operating system and network.
Buying a smartphone is like buying a PC, there will be some programs bundled with it. But you can add whatever you want. A featurephone tries to copy some of the best programs from a smartphone but you are stuck with them.

I have the exact same grudges against my N73.
No video ringtone, no screensavers (cant have a picture of my kid pop up after like 20 seconds), you cant turn java games' volume down like with standard phones by just using the volume keys, cant have full screen wallpaper.... they are crap!
Plus one of the worst things is you cant specify what you want to appear in the gallery.. so when i put the TomTom software on the phone, i went to the gallery, and it had about 50 pictures of different road signs that was part of TomTom.

I've looked EVERYWHERE for programs to sort out these issues and have been unsuccessful. Either it says the needed program doesnt exist yet for the S60E3 or the ones that do exist dont do the job properly ie.

ThemeDIY - yes it can create full screen wallpapers, buts its a full theme - but doesnt allow you to use a gif file or normal pictures as screensavers - which you could probably do on an old SonyEricsson T68i.

Slide Screensaver - You can use many images to appear as a slideshow - but whats the point, as the screensaver only kicks in when the phone is in power save mode, which means the screen is black, and you cant even see these pictures.
